Tareas

Solo disponible en BuenasTareas
  • Páginas : 2 (376 palabras )
  • Descarga(s) : 0
  • Publicado : 15 de febrero de 2011
Leer documento completo
Vista previa del texto
Cuestionario Unidades V y VI

1. Defina ordenamiento interno y externo

R=

Los internos:

Son aquellos en los que los valores a ordenar están en memoriaprincipal, por lo que se asume queel tiempo que se requiere para acceder cualquier elemento sea el mismo (a[1], a[500], etc).

Los externos:

Son aquellos en los que los valoresa ordenar están en memoria secundaria (disco, cinta,cilindro magnético, etc), por lo que se asume que el tiempo que se requiere para acceder a cualquier elemento depende de la última posición accesada (posición 1, posición 500, etc).

2. ¿Cuálesson los métodos directos de ordenamiento más populares?
R= inserción, selección y seleccion

3. ¿Cuáles son los pasos a seguir para realizar ordenamiento por selección?
R= -primero encontrar el elemento menor del arreglo.
- Ese elemento se coloca como el primero
- Repetir esta operación hasta acomodar todos los elementos

4. Describa el método deordenamiento Shell y explique por qué se llama así
R= es una mejora al método de inserción directa y se utiliza cuando el numero de elementos es muy grande y se le denomina así por su creador donaldShell.

5. ¿En que estrategia se basa el método de ordenamiento rápido o “quickSort”?
R= este se basa en la estrategia de “ divide y venceras” se divide en dos sublistas una de elementosmenores y otra de mayores.

6. Defina brevemente búsqueda y cuales son los métodos más usuales de búsqueda
R=es la recuperación de información o localizar la ubicación de un elemento, y los masusados son búsqueda secuencial y binaria.

7. ¿Cual es el método más sencillo de búsqueda y por que?

8. ¿Qué es la búsqueda secuencial con centinela?
Es una forma mas eficaz derealizar la búsqueda secuencial que consiste en modificar el algoritmos anteriores agregando un valor centinela al vector y evita algunas comparaciones.

9. ¿Qué ventajas tiene la búsqueda binaria...
tracking img